    We came Dough on a blazing hot Sunday for lunch. The entrance walls had some wonderful patriotic arts. They had tables available both indoor and outdoor, we decided to sit in the outdoor patio area. It looked very nice at start, but gradually the heat started to pick up. There was no fan or anything other than rare natural breeze. For indoor, the dining area was really nice, with mostly had high chair tables. The bar was huge. The menu had lots variety in brunch, small plates, greens, sandwiches, pizzas, pastas and seasonal entrees. The drinks menu had cocktails, mocktails and lots of other hard liquor options. We started the lunch with deviled eggs and zucchini crisps. Both were decent dishes. Zucchini crisp had lots of them with a tasty side of sauce. For entree, I got the hanger steak sandwich. The sandwich had good amount of steak, topped with onion and greens. But the steak pieces were huge that made it difficult to bite out of the sandwich. Having it in thinner slices or cubes would have been much better. The sourdough bread's crust also got super hard, was impossible me to bite around the corner. I had to tear off the edges of the bread. The grilled salmon was a big filet, really well cooked. But the lemon risotto was bland. My daughter got the kid's Mac and cheese that was excellent, whole plate was full of cheese. The mint condition and raspberry mule were solid mocktails to cool off the heatwave we were feeling. The service was decent overall. The dishes came out in short intervals. Our server was working hard, trying her best to keep up with multiple tables. We had to get her attention to request the utensils, takeout boxes and for the check. Hopefully she will get better as she gets more experience. By the time we done, the restaurant was fully packed, barely any space left in their parking lot.

    Met up with friends for some wood-fired pizza, and this place was perfect for it! The restaurant feels like stepping into a beautiful log cabin--cozy and intimate for date nights, yet spacious enough for larger groups. They also have a full bar, craft beer and offer much more than just pizza, including vegan options, a great selection of appetizers, salads, handcrafted pastas, plus fish and steak dishes. The menu is really well done. We decided to share a few pizzas since the brick oven was calling our name: Margherita - fresh mozzarella, tomato sauce, and basil Pesto Chicken - wood-fired chicken, fresh basil, mozzarella, Fontina, and basil pesto Smokey the Pig - smoked mozzarella, baked prosciutto, field mushrooms, fresh garlic, and EVOO For dessert, we shared the coconut cake. It's plant-based, made with coconut milk and brown sugar, and topped with coconut flakes. The portion was easily enough for four people and absolutely delicious--super fresh and flavorful. Our server, Tara, was wonderful--so sweet and attentive. She checked in often, kept our drinks filled, and made sure we enjoyed everything from the food to dessert. I'll definitely be back to try more dishes!
